The 2nd year Fine Art Print, National College of Art & Design are pleased to announce their end of year exhibition Super Fine at the Joinery Gallery, Dublin.

Image credit: Orla Goodwin: Model for Vermeer, digital print, 2011.
This is the first time the 2nd year students of the Fine Art Print department have exhibited together. The exhibition will consist of a diverse range of processes and media including intaglio, lithography, screen, and digital print processes, as well as sculpture and media from the past academic year. Although artistic concerns differ from artist to artist, issues relating to the individual in today’s culture and society are principally addressed.
The contemporary nature of the Joinery Gallery is particularly appropriate to their collective concerns as a group of emerging artists.
